Requirements to Teach in Taiwan

Even as a beginner, there are a few key requirements to Teach English in Taiwan legally.

Education

A bachelor’s degree from an English-speaking country is typically required. This allows you to Teach English in Taiwan and obtain a legal work visa.

Language Skills

Native-level English proficiency is essential. Teachers who Teach English in Taiwan must communicate clearly with students of all ages.

Optional Certification

TEFL or TESOL certificates are helpful but not mandatory. Many first-time teachers successfully Teach English in Taiwan without formal certification.

Step-by-Step Guide to Get Started

Step 1: Research Schools and Programs

Focus on verified schools or trusted placement programs to Teach English in Taiwan safely.

Step 2: Prepare Your Application

Include your resume, bachelor’s degree, passport copy, and optional recommendation letters. Teachers who Teach English in Taiwan benefit from clear and professional applications.

Step 3: Online Interviews

Schools hiring teachers who Teach English in Taiwan look for enthusiasm, adaptability, and communication skills. Prior experience is often secondary.

Step 4: Visa and Work Permit

Your employer sponsors your work permit, allowing you to obtain a resident visa and Alien Resident Certificate (ARC). Teachers who Teach English in Taiwan must complete these steps to work legally.

Step 5: Arrival and Orientation

Arrange housing and travel in advance. Many schools provide guidance and cultural orientation. Teachers who Teach English in Taiwan find this preparation helps them adjust quickly.
